Abstract

Nitrogen doped titanium photocatalysts with different nitrogen containing organic compounds were prepared by sol–gel method in acidic media. Among different nitrogen containing organic compounds, triethylamine doped TiO2 showed better photocatalytic activity under visible light. XRD, SEM and TEM analyses showed that the crystalline size of N-doped TiO2 was in the range of 20–24 nm. XRD and Raman spectrum showed that all peaks of N-doped TiO2 correspond to anatase crystalline structure. The formation of O–Ti–N bond in N-doped TiO2 does not lead to any new Raman band. XPS study confirmed that N replaces the O in the lattice of TiO2 and is present in the form of O–Ti–N. The photocatalytic activity of doped TiO2 was measured under UV and visible light using lindane as a target pollutant. The photocatalytic activity of anatase TiO2 and N-doped TiO2 was compared with commercially available Degussa P-25 TiO2. Intermediates formed during the degradation of lindane were monitored by GC–MS analysis.
